Five FC Kansas City players to train with U.S. national team

Lauren Holiday, the 2014 U.S. Soccer Female Athlete of the Year, headlines a group of five FC Kansas City players invited to training camp with the women’s national team in preparation for the World Cup.

She will be joined by goalkeeper Nicole Barnhart, defender Becky Sauerbrunn, midfielder Heather O’Reilly and forward Amy Rodriguez on the 29-player roster which will be cut down to 23 this June.

The team will return to action on Feb. 8 when it faces France in Lorient. The U.S. also will face England on Feb. 13 in Milton Keynes.
